Non-tender Papular Lesion On Labia Majora, Thumb Joint Space. History Of Ganglion Cyst. Any Thoughts?

I have begun to notice several non-tender papular lesions on the following 2 body parts - right lebia majora, over the metacarpal/ thumb joint space of the right hand, I have had what I think is a ganglion cyst on the palmer surface of the left, distal ulnar, likely unrelated. I am nearly 61, female, in good health, and take Prozac . your thoughts.

Orthopaedic Surgeon 's  Response
Hello,

I have studied your case with diligence.
Lesion over meta-carpal can be ganglion.
Cystic lesions are usually benign and surgical excision is definitive treatment.
As you have multiple cyst decision should be take by your treating doctor regarding plan of treatment.
Lesion on labia can be infectious lesion.
Clinical photo of swelling can give more information regarding cause of lesion.
